Naughtius Maximus Posted June 15, 2016 Share Posted June 15, 2016 (edited) So, Kratos really is the protagonist of the game, huh? I don't know but in any way, it seems forced. I mean, with GoW III, Kratos' story is pretty much tied up well, and considering that the upcoming new game will focus on Norse mythology, why not have a new protagonist? Although all mythologies have too much in common, Norse mythology has its own share of eccentric stuff and charm, apart from Greek mythology. I'd have preffered a new protagonist created solely for this Norse myth centric game. Sure, he would have shared lots of similar characteristics with Kratos, but would still be an outstanding persona of his own. Therefore, I feel like Kratos is way too much forced and pushed in already. I'd have been excited and relieved much more if the creators would come up with something fresh. Arlarse Posted June 17, 2016 Share Posted June 17, 2016 ^^ If thats true it adds another pretty awesome layer to the game. Really am looking forward to it. The changes all look for the better as well, and you can see Santa Monica has been taking some inspiration from Naughty Dog. Kratos is in previous games was superficially awesome but fundamentally an antagonist, driven solely to destroy those who opposed him. I think that was fun but at the same time its not something with any longevity to it. I like the idea that he's actually a conflicted anti-hero and I feel thats where they're going to take him as a character. His son is the other interesting layer to the game. They've confirmed he won't be playable but you can level him so I wonder if he'll be someone who comes to the forefront in future titles after God of War.
